Common Cub Cadet Electrical Problems

Now we are going to discuss the most common electrical problems that occur in almost every model of cub cadet.

Faulty Starter Motor: 

A common electrical issue is a malfunctioning starter motor. If your mower won’t start, this could be the culprit.

Solution: Replace the starter motor with a new one, and ensure proper connections.

Dead Battery: 

This is the most common electrical problem because a dead battery can leave you stranded in the middle of your yard.

Solution: Check the battery, if it is not charged then charged it. Also inspect the terminals of the battery. If the battery is dead, then replace it.

Wiring Issues:

 Frayed or damaged wires can lead to electrical problems. Because if your wiring system is damaged, then your mower is not started.

Solution: Inspect the wiring, if they are faulty wires then repair it or replace damaged sections, and ensure secure connections.

Faulty Ignition Switch: 

If your mower doesn’t respond when you turn the key, the ignition switch may be the issue.

Solution: Replace the ignition switch and ensure proper installation.

Troubleshooting Cub Cadet Clutch Problems

Slipping Clutch:

 A slipping clutch can lead to uneven mowing and reduced efficiency.

Solution: Adjust the clutch engagement and, if necessary, replace the clutch.

Clutch Won’t Engage:

 If the clutch won’t engage, your mower won’t move.

Solution: Check the clutch cable, adjust as needed, or replace it if it’s worn.

Maintenance Tips to Prevent Future Issues

Prevention is often the best cure when it comes to mower problems. Here are some maintenance tips to keep your Cub Cadet ZT1 54 in peak condition:

  • Regularly clean the mower and remove debris.
  • Check the oil levels and change the oil as recommended.
  • Sharpen and balance the mower blades.
  • Inspect the air filter and replace it if it’s clogged.
  • Keep the tires properly inflated.
